Afrobytes cofounders Ammin Youssouf and Haweya Mohamed have organised #Afrobytes, an international tech conference taking place from June 9 to 12 in Paris.

Afrobytes is a Paris-based digital hub focused on African tech and innovation. The conference is taking place during the Futur en Seine Festival and seeks to be an international platform for Africa-based and diaspora entrepreneurs and investors to meet.

With panels such as ‘Meet the African Hubs’ and ‘Investing in African Startups’ the events promise to provide a place to network and learn. TRUE Africa are media partners of the conference – editor-in-chief Claude Grunitzky will also be taking part in a panel.
